Comparing Wood and Composite Options

Selecting the most suitable choices for an outdoor deck demands a careful balance of style and durability. Residents often face the dilemma between traditional wood and composite materials. Timber, often chosen for its organic appeal and warmth, offers a enduring appearance but may demand regular care to guard against deterioration and warping. Conversely, composite lumber, crafted from a mixture of recycled wood fibers and plastic, provides a hassle-free alternative, withstanding discoloration and splintering over time. Whereas wood can elevate a timeless appearance, composites offer a current attraction with a range of finishes and textures. At the end of the day, the selection is based on personal preferences, budget considerations, and desired longevity, making it essential for property owners to consider the benefits of each option carefully.

Weather Resistance Elements

When evaluating outdoor deck materials, having a clear understanding of weather resistance is vital for ensuring long-term durability and aesthetic appeal. Different materials react uniquely to environmental conditions, influencing their lifespan and maintenance needs. To illustrate, composite decking is built to handle moisture, UV radiation, and temperature variations, making it an ideal selection for homeowners who want minimal upkeep. On the other hand, conventional wood is prone to decay and insect infestation when not adequately treated and maintained. Additionally, climate is a key factor; areas with high humidity may favor materials with enhanced moisture resistance. Ultimately, picking the ideal decking material means finding the right balance between durability, design, and local weather considerations, guaranteeing a stunning outdoor environment that can stand up to weather conditions.

How to Get Your Deck Ready for Every Season

Maintaining a deck for each season guarantees its longevity and improves use throughout the year. In spring, homeowners should inspect for damage from winter, thoroughly clean the deck, and use a quality sealant to guard against moisture. Summer preparations involve consistent upkeep and confirming that furniture and accessories are UV-resistant to avoid discoloration.

As autumn arrives, it's essential to clean up leaves and debris to guard against mold and mildew, while also inspecting for loose boards or nails. Finally, preparing for winter calls for a comprehensive cleaning and using an ice-melting agent to prevent damage from snow and ice.

Protecting the deck with a protective tarp can further protect it from damaging environmental factors. By adhering to these seasonal preparations, homeowners can be confident their decks stay safe, functional, and visually appealing year-round, enhancing outdoor recreation regardless of the season.

Tips for Maintaining Your Deck's Longevity

Maintaining a deck necessitates regular focus and effort to guarantee its lasting beauty and structural integrity. Routine cleaning plays a vital role; removing debris and scrubbing the surface with a mild cleaning solution helps prevent the growth of mold and mildew. Checking for loose boards, nails, or screws is essential, as they may result in safety risks and further deterioration.

Adding a protective sealant every couple of years can protect the wood from humidity and sun exposure, extending its life considerably. As seasons change, it is wise to inspect for indicators of damage, such as fading or splintering, and tackle these concerns without delay. Additionally, keeping planters and furniture elevated can prevent moisture accumulation underneath. By following these upkeep guidelines, homeowners can ensure their decks continue to be safe, beautiful, and practical for the long term.

What Is the Average Time Frame for a Deck Installation?

A standard deck installation generally takes one to three weeks on average, depending on the size, materials, and complexity of the project. The overall timeline can also be impacted by weather conditions and site preparation.

What Permits Do You Need for Deck Construction?

In most cases, deck construction requires official permits, which may include zoning clearances and structural evaluations. Local regulations vary, so consulting a municipal office or a licensed contractor is essential to confirm compliance with applicable requirements.

Can I Build a Deck on Uneven Ground?

Building a deck on uneven ground is feasible, but requires careful planning and suitable techniques, such as using a elevated structure or adaptable footings. Proper drainage and reinforcement are essential to guarantee safety and longevity.

What Is the Standard Cost of Installing a Deck?

The average cost of deck installation generally falls from $15 to $35 per square foot, depending on the choice of materials, the complexity of the design, and local labor rates. Property owners should factor in supplementary costs for necessary permits and site preparation work.

Are Environmentally Friendly Decking Options Available?

There are eco-friendly decking options available, such as composite materials crafted from recycled plastics and wood fibers, ethically sourced hardwoods, and bamboo alternatives. These alternatives reduce environmental impact while providing durable and attractive outdoor solutions.
